If  9(√x)=(√(12))+(√(147)), then the value  of x is

(√(12)) =2(√3)    (√(147)) =7(√3)   9(√x) =2(√3) +7(√3) =9(√3)   x=3

squaring both side  81x=12+147+2×2(√3)×7(√3)  81x=159+84  x=243/81=3
